City Auto Parts
- Address
 - 111 N Market St
 - Place
 - Scottsboro , AL 35768-1818
 - Landline
 - (256) 574-2606
 
Description
City Auto Parts can be found at 111 N Market St . The following is offered: Car Parts - In Scottsboro there are 9 other Car Parts.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Car Parts(256)574-2606 (256)-574-2606 +12565742606